The Soil Association also published the ranking of rankinghow healthy children's food in 21 chain stores.
Parents offer Jamie the healthiest choice for children in his Italian restaurant.
But what they feel is the least healthy choice for their children.
At the end was the Burger King chain, followed by the KFC chicken restaurant.
Jamie's Italian, who also won the top 2013 in the first league table, is the only chain that can tell parents where the meat comes from.
Mr. Percival said: "Our 2015 league games include big winners and big losers.

Hayley Coristine of the Soil Association told independents that eating at a more expensive restaurant does not mean that food will be healthier.
"When parents go out to eat, they usually want the best for their children, and sometimes they think the price will have an impact on that.
Unfortunately, we find that this is not the case.
Some of the more affordable options, like Wetherspoons and Harvester, are in the top five of the charts.

But research by the Soil Association does reveal some shifts to healthier choices.
Now, a total of 10 restaurants offer a vegetable or salad for each child, an increase from 6 in 2013.
